Telomerase Activation Studies
Research suggests that Epithalon may activate telomerase, an enzyme associated with maintaining telomere length and cellular longevity.
Aging and Longevity Models
Preclinical studies have explored its role in slowing age-related cellular decline and improving lifespan markers.
Sleep and Circadian Rhythm Research
Epithalon has been studied for its influence on melatonin regulation and circadian rhythm stability.
Cellular Regulation Models
Research indicates potential effects on gene expression related to aging and repair processes.
